In a patient taking torsemide 20 mg daily who has a serum potassium of 4.7 mmol/L and evidence of volume overload (edema, dyspnea, weight gain), is it appropriate to increase the torsemide dose to 40 mg daily and what laboratory and clinical monitoring should be performed?

Increasing Torsemide from 20 mg to 40 mg with Potassium 4.7 mmol/L

Yes, increase torsemide from 20 mg to 40 mg daily—a potassium of 4.7 mmol/L is normal and does not contraindicate dose escalation. 1

Rationale for Dose Increase

  • Torsemide can be safely titrated from an initial dose of 10-20 mg up to a maximum of 200 mg daily for heart failure edema, with dose adjustments made based on clinical response rather than arbitrary electrolyte thresholds. 1, 2
  • The European Society of Cardiology recommends starting with low doses and increasing until clinical improvement of congestion symptoms occurs, then maintaining the lowest effective dose to achieve "dry weight." 3
  • A serum potassium of 4.7 mmol/L falls within the normal range (3.5-5.0 mmol/L) and represents optimal potassium status—this level actually provides a safety buffer for diuretic intensification. 1

Clinical Assessment Before Dose Escalation

  • Verify evidence of persistent volume overload: peripheral edema, elevated jugular venous pressure, dyspnea, or weight gain despite current therapy. 1
  • Confirm systolic blood pressure ≥90-100 mmHg to ensure adequate perfusion for effective diuresis. 1, 4
  • Exclude severe hyponatremia (serum sodium <125 mmol/L), which would be an absolute contraindication to dose increase. 3, 1

Monitoring After Dose Increase

  • Assess clinical response within 1-2 days by monitoring weight loss (target 0.5-1.0 kg/day), reduction in peripheral edema, and resolution of jugular venous distention. 1, 2
  • Check electrolytes (sodium, potassium, magnesium) and renal function within 3-7 days after the dose change, then weekly during active titration. 1, 2
  • Monitor daily weights at the same time each day to track fluid balance and avoid excessive diuresis. 1

Advantages of Torsemide Over Furosemide

  • Torsemide has superior bioavailability (>80%) and a longer duration of action (12-16 hours) compared to furosemide (6-8 hours), allowing reliable once-daily dosing. 1, 2, 5, 6
  • Torsemide maintains efficacy independent of renal function, making it particularly suitable for patients with chronic kidney disease (GFR <30 mL/min). 2, 6
  • Torsemide causes less potassium and calcium wasting than furosemide, reducing the risk of hypokalemia during dose escalation. 6, 7

Managing Diuretic Resistance if 40 mg Proves Insufficient

  • If 40 mg torsemide fails to produce adequate diuresis after 24-48 hours, increase to 60-80 mg daily before considering combination therapy. 1, 2
  • If maximum torsemide doses (up to 200 mg daily) are ineffective, add sequential nephron blockade with a thiazide diuretic (metolazone 2.5-5 mg or hydrochlorothiazide 25 mg) rather than further escalating torsemide alone. 1, 2
  • Measure spot urine sodium 2 hours after torsemide administration—a level <50-70 mEq/L indicates insufficient diuretic response requiring intervention. 1

Critical Contraindications to Dose Escalation

  • Severe hypokalemia (<3.0 mmol/L) requires potassium repletion before increasing diuretics. 1, 2
  • Severe hyponatremia (serum sodium <120-125 mmol/L) mandates temporary discontinuation of all diuretics. 3, 1
  • Progressive renal failure, anuria, or marked hypotension (SBP <90 mmHg) are absolute contraindications. 1, 4

Common Pitfalls to Avoid

  • Do not withhold diuretic escalation based on "normal-high" potassium levels—a potassium of 4.7 mmol/L provides a protective buffer against hypokalemia during intensified diuresis. 1
  • Ensure the patient is on guideline-directed medical therapy (ACE inhibitors/ARBs, beta-blockers, mineralocorticoid receptor antagonists) rather than using diuretics as monotherapy. 1, 2
  • Eliminate factors blocking diuretic efficacy: excessive dietary sodium intake (restrict to <2-3 g/day), NSAIDs/COX-2 inhibitors (discontinue immediately), and significant renal dysfunction. 1, 2
  • Avoid underdosing—the European Society of Cardiology lists usual daily torsemide doses of 10-20 mg, but doses up to 200 mg may be required for adequate decongestion. 3, 2
